A police force has apologised after a disabled child and his parents were detained at a Channel crossing point under the Terrorism Act.

The white couple with the mixed race disabled child were accused of child trafficking. What all this had to to with the Terrorism Act and ant-terrorist police is beyond me. Is there some connection I have missed other than the obvious erosion of civil liberties?
